As I've got older, over 35, I've started having the odd long cycle, either where ovulation was delayed or I assume I've not ovulated, think I've been 10 or so days late a couple of times. Think it's quite common as you get older op or ovulation can be delayed due to illness or stress therefore your cycle ends up being longer.
